Guaranteed porting for a heterogeneous UNIX environment.

Use a componentized build system to automatically port Java™ projects with native extensions on heterogeneous UNIX® platforms. Today, many large-scale Java systems running on UNIX-like platforms require third-party native library support, or you have to develop your own native components. Many utilities and system calls on these platforms do not have corresponding Java wrappers. Constructing a "Write once, run anywhere" Java application under these environments requires maintenance of separate native source sets, and integrating a separate build system for every platform has many shortcomings.more
